Terrorize Meaning in English

word

ˈtɛɹɝˌaɪz
TER-er-ize
ˈtɛɹəɹaɪz
TER-uh-rize

释义

To make someone feel very afraid, often by repeatedly threatening them or using violence.

用法与细微差别

Most common in formal, journalistic, or legal contexts about bullying, war, or crime. Often used with forms like 'terrorize people/neighbors.' Do not confuse with 'terrify,' which means to scare greatly, but not usually with the idea of repeated threats.
